Many people end up with cavities between their teeth, and the reason is that they don't floss and brushing alone doesn't get all the food out. It's best to floss after you brush your teeth twice a day, but once a day is better than none at all, of course!

Keep your toothbrush as clean as can be. Otherwise, you may be attracting bacteria to the bristles that then infect your mouth! Wash the bristles after every brushing, and stand your toothbrush upright so that any additional water drains down the brush. Be sure to replace your brush every few months even when you clean it well.

If your gums bleed easily, don't just put up with it--see your dentist right away! Bloody, sensitive gums can be an indication of a gum infection that requires antibiotics. Infections can spread to the teeth or to other parts of the body, so you want to get them taken care of as soon as possible.

If you experience any pain when brushing your teeth, be sure to consult your dentist about your problem. Pain while brushing, as well as sensitivity to temperature extremes, may be a sign of a deeper dental problem. Your dentist can identify any underlying problems that may exist. In the meantime, use dental hygiene products labeled for use by those with sensitive teeth because these products will sooth and calm the mouth and gums.

To help your child build the habit of flossing, buy him a pack of the plastic flossers. For many children, the task of winding floss around their fingers and then cleaning between their teeth is too difficult. The plastic flossers are a great tool for teaching the habit of flossing until coordination builds enough to allow flossing using your hands.
